About the Collections
The MBC collects, preserves, and presents historic and contemporary radio and television content. Preserving television and radio is valuable in documenting the American experience. Providing access to these primary sources of history is central to the MBC‘s mission.
Programs The MBC Collection spans the history of broadcasting and includes more than 25,000 television programs, 5,000 radio programs, and 12,000 commercials totaling almost 100,000 hours. Over 8,500 program assets have already been digitized.

Artifacts
The MBC also holds more than 1,800 objects that helped shape radio and television history, including:
- Vintage Radios and Televisions: These artifacts trace the advancement in delivery technology that allowed millions of Americans to listen and watch.
- Kennedy-Nixon Camera: The original camera used in the historic 1960 event; the first televised presidential debate was held at WBBM-TV in Chicago.
- Puppets, Costumes, and Props: Puppets include Charlie McCarthy, Garfield Goose, and Dirty Dragon. We also house the costumes for the cast of Bozo as the Grand Prize Game.

Photographs
The MBC has also digitized much of its collection of more than 3,500 photographs from broadcasting history. Most of our photographs are available in the online Archives catalog.
